Wiper Refills for the 2009 Audi Q5: What You Need to Know

The 2009 Audi Q5 is a well-engineered SUV that comes equipped with high-quality windshield wipers designed to keep visibility clear and safe through Australia's unpredictable weather. When it comes to maintenance, knowing whether your vehicle uses wiper refills can be quite helpful. For the 2009 Audi Q5, it's important to clarify the role of wiper refills and how they fit in with the vehicle's overall wiper system.

Firstly, a quick note on what wiper refills actually are. A wiper refill is a thin strip of rubber that fits into the metal or plastic wiper blade frame. Over time, the rubber strip wears out from exposure to sun, rain, and debris. Instead of replacing the entire wiper blade assembly, many drivers choose to replace just the refill strip to extend the life of their blades and keep their windscreen wiping effectively. This approach is often more economical and environmentally friendly.

Now, the 2009 Audi Q5, like many modern vehicles, typically comes with a set of fully integrated wiper blades rather than blades designed for replacement refills. These are often referred to as "beam" or "flat" blades. The design of these blades is sleek and aerodynamic, improving their performance at highway speeds and offering superior wiping across the curve of the windscreen. Because of their design, beam blades skip the refill strip concept altogether, coming as one complete piece where the rubber element is directly bonded to the frame.

This means that the 2009 Audi Q5 does not generally use traditional wiper refills. Instead, when the rubber on the wiper blades starts to wear or degrade - which could lead to smearing, streaking, or noise - the entire wiper blade unit is usually replaced as a whole. The bonded rubber on beam blades cannot easily be swapped out like a refill, making new blades the best option.

So why aren't wiper refills commonly used or recommended on vehicles like the 2009 Audi Q5? A few reasons stand out:

  • Advanced Blade Design: The aerodynamic beam-style blades are engineered to hold their shape and maintain optimal pressure against the windscreen edge-to-edge without the need for separate refills.
  • Improved Durability: Beam blades tend to last longer than traditional framed blades with refills, as the bonded rubber resists splitting and tearing more effectively.
  • Performance: Flat and beam blades reduce wind lift, chatter and noise, providing better wiping performance that is difficult to replicate with refill-based blades.
  • Convenience: Whole blade replacement simplifies maintenance for owners, swapping out a ready-to-install set rather than having to carefully insert a refill strip.

However, this doesn't mean wiper maintenance isn't important for the 2009 Audi Q5. Replacing worn wiper blades regularly remains one of the easiest and most crucial steps to keeping your view clear and driving safely. Most experts recommend checking your blades every six months or so, and replacing them promptly when you notice smearing, split rubber, or reduced wiping efficiency. Frequent exposure to Australian sun and dust can accelerate wear, so being mindful about this pays off in good visibility.

When servicing the wipers on a 2009 Audi Q5, it is best to purchase high-quality replacement wiper blades designed specifically for beam-style systems. These are often branded by Audi or reputable aftermarket suppliers and come ready to fit the unique mounting system of the vehicle. Installation is usually straightforward and can be a quick DIY job, requiring only that the old blades are unclipped and the new ones snapped into place.

In terms of maintenance tips beyond replacement, it's useful to keep the following in mind:

  • Regularly clean the wiper blades by gently wiping the rubber with a damp cloth to remove dirt and grime.
  • Check the windscreen for any cracks or residue that could damage the blades or reduce their effectiveness.
  • Avoid using the wipers on a dry screen as this accelerates rubber wear and can cause scratching.
  • Clear snow, ice, or debris from the blades and screen before use to prevent damage.

Overall, though the 2009 Audi Q5 does not use traditional wiper refills, it benefits from modern, integrated beam-style blades that provide excellent performance and longevity. Regularly replacing the entire blade unit rather than just a rubber refill ensures that drivers maintain optimal visibility on the road. Doing so as part of routine servicing helps Aussie drivers tackle everything from dusty outback drives to wet city streets with confidence and safety.
